British P1853 Artillery sword bayonet 2nd Type

Yataghan blade 576mm, overall 711mm with checkered leather grips similar to the Pattern 1856 infantry bayonet. Both the P1853 and P1856 bayonets commonlyhave a rivet that secures the latch spring but this example has a screw, which is perfectly acceptable but less commonly seen. This pattern is distinguished by a half inch groove cut in front of the mortise slot to accommodate the bayonet stud on the Pattern 1853 Carbine. Supplied with a steel scabbard marked RA (Royal Artillery) 33, F/16Bd. Crossguard is marked G.16.RA with 71 on the opposite side. Blake maker is Johann Bleckmann, Solingen and bears his bow and arrow trademark with BM stamped inside. Very good condition bayonet and interesting example not commonly seen.
